Hoppa till huvudinnehåll

2024-05-01

US DEA föreslår omklassificering av marijuana

  • U.S. Drug Enforcement Administration överväger att omklassificera marijuana till en mindre farlig drog, vilket potentiellt kan omforma narkotikapolitiken i landet.
  • President Biden stödjer en översyn av de federala marijuana-lagarna och har beviljat nåd till personer som dömts för innehav.
  • Den föreslagna förändringen kan anpassa den federala narkotikapolitiken till delstaternas legaliseringsrörelser och tilltala yngre väljare, vilket kan gynna president Bidens offentliga image.

Reaktioner

  • Diskussionen fördjupar sig i olika aspekter av legalisering och reglering av marijuana i USA, såsom omklassificering, påverkan av bankregler, apotekssäkerhet, affärsutmaningar och användning av kryptovaluta för transaktioner.
  • Den utforskar också effekterna av federala lagar, detaljhandelsmarknaden för marijuana och olika synpunkter på droganvändning och legalisering.
  • Felaktig information, nätdroger och storföretagens inflytande på marknaden är några av de frågor som lyfts fram i diskussionen.

Utforska musikalisk notation i CSS Grid

  • Scribe-prototypen använder CSS Grid för att generera ett rutnätsliknande notsystem för att förbättra tillgängligheten och smidigheten för musiknotation på webben.
  • Den visar hur man placerar musikaliska symboler på en stav med hjälp av CSS-rutnät och dataattribut, ändrar layout och avstånd med hjälp av CSS samt belyser systemets begränsningar och potentiella förbättringar.
  • Ytterligare funktioner inkluderar stave splitting för trummor och piano, multi-stave rendering och erbjuder ett transponerbart lead sheet för en jazzstandard.

Reaktioner

  • Artikeln fördjupar sig i att använda CSS Grid för musiknotation och beskriver dess fördelar och begränsningar.
  • Kommentatorer föreslår förbättringar av CSS, med sikte på en mer effektiv lösning för musiksättning.
  • Användare utbyter åsikter om rendering av musiknotation och utforskar olika verktyg och alternativ, och uttrycker varierande åsikter om CSS effektivitet i jämförelse med andra metoder.

Effektivisera automatiseringen av infrastruktur med Pyinfra

  • pyinfra är ett Python-verktyg för automatisering av infrastruktur, med snabbhet, skalbarhet och mångsidighet för ad hoc-kommandon, distribution av tjänster och konfigurationshantering.
  • Den erbjuder snabb exekvering, omedelbar felsökning, idempotenta operationer och integration med connectorer, vilket gör den till en heltäckande lösning för automatisering av infrastruktur.
  • Användare kan installera pyinfra via pip, köra kommandon via SSH, definiera tillstånd med hjälp av operationer och distribuera uppgifter med hjälp av Python-kod, med flexibiliteten att utöka den med hjälp av Python-paketekosystemet.

Reaktioner

  • Jämförelse av verktyg för automatisering av infrastruktur som Pyinfra, Ansible, Puppet och Terraform baserat på deklarativa och imperativa metoder, komplexitet, fördelar och begränsningar.
  • Användare lovordar Python-baserade Pyinfra för automatiseringsuppgifter, uttrycker oro över Ansible- och Puppet-begränsningar och betonar vikten av tillståndshantering vid automatisering av infrastruktur.
  • Diskussionen omfattar utmaningarna med att effektivt hantera stora serverparker, fördelarna med deklarativ programmering och balansen mellan DRY-programmeringsprinciper och enkelhet i konfigurationshanteringen.

Borgo: Ett statiskt typat språk som kompilerar till Go

  • Borgo är ett nytt programmeringsspråk som transponeras till Go och kombinerar Go:s enkelhet med Rust:s uttrycksfullhet.
  • Den innehåller algebraiska datatyper, mönstermatchning, felhantering med operatorn ? och är kompatibel med befintliga Go-paket.
  • Borgos syntax liknar Rust, med valfria semikolon, och erbjuder funktioner som Option för nilhantering, Result för flera returvärden, demonstrerat genom ett exempel på en gissningslek.

Reaktioner

  • Diskussionen fördjupar sig i Borgo, ett språk som transponeras till Go, tar itu med vanliga frustrationer med Go-kod och erbjuder ytterligare funktioner som enum och valfria typer.
  • Användarna är fascinerade av Borgos funktioner, pekar på för- och nackdelar med egensinniga språk som Go, diskuterar felhantering via try/catch i jämförelse med Go:s felhantering och lyfter fram vikten av idiomatiska namnkonventioner.
  • Samtalet handlar också om skillnaderna mellan kompilatorer och transpilatorer, utmaningar med bakåtkompatibilitet och exempel på språk som kompileras till andra språk, med fokus på språkdesign, felhantering och kompatibilitet mellan olika språk.

Reddit avslöjad: Bots repostar tråd 10 månader senare

  • Reddit-användarna Blaze och Lemmy.world upptäckte att robotar postade om en hel tråd, kommentar för kommentar, på samma sätt efter 10 månader.
  • Den här upptäckten visar att det finns botar på Reddit som utför repetitiva beteenden och potentiellt kan manipulera diskussioner.
  • Incidenten väcker frågor om äktheten i användarinteraktioner och innehåll på plattformen, och understryker vikten av att upptäcka och hantera bot-aktiviteter.

Reaktioner

  • Reddit-konversationer fokuserar på frågor som robotar som lägger upp innehåll, falska konton som marknadsför produkter och potentiell manipulering av diskussioner genom AI-genererat innehåll.
  • Oro över informationens tillförlitlighet, partiska Wikipedia-redigeringar och företagspåverkan är vanliga ämnen.
  • Lösningsförslagen omfattar identifieringssystem online, passverifiering och att använda hundar för att bekämpa robotar för att hantera dessa utmaningar.

Extension.js: Strömlinjeformat verktyg för att skapa webbtillägg

  • Extension.js är ett utvecklingsverktyg för webbläsartillägg som effektiviserar processen genom att erbjuda inbyggt stöd för TypeScript, WebAssembly, React och modern JavaScript.
  • Det tar bort kravet på komplexa konfigurationer och installationsinstruktioner, vilket gör att utvecklarna kan koncentrera sig på att koda.
  • Verktyget kan sömlöst integreras i npm-skript, vilket förenklar skapandet av tillägg för flera webbläsare utan behov av byggkonfiguration. Verktyget skapades ursprungligen för att utbilda om utveckling av tillägg, men är nu öppet för allmän användning och feedback uppmuntras.

Reaktioner

  • Extension.js är ett CLI-verktyg som förenklar skapandet av webbtillägg med stöd för TypeScript, WebAssembly, React och modern JavaScript, fullt kompatibelt med Chrome och Edge och med framtida kompatibilitet med Firefox och Safari på agendan.
  • Diskussioner på plattformar som Github och HN fokuserar på funktioner i Extension.js, jämförelser med ramverk som Plasmo och strategier för modifiering av webbsidor och SPA med hjälp av verktyg som Mutation Observers och CSS.
  • Community feedback innebär förbättringsförslag och kommande planer för webbläsarstöd för Extension.js.

Filsystemet File: Manipulera moderna data med Unix-verktyg

  • ffs är ett filsystem som låter användare montera halvstrukturerad data som JSON på ett Unix-filsystem, vilket möjliggör manipulation med vanliga skalverktyg.
  • Den stöder JSON-, YAML- och TOML-format, möjliggör filredigering på plats, kräver FUSE på Linux och macFUSE på macOS och är licensierad under GPLv3.
  • ffs har utvecklats av mgree och erbjuder en annan metod för databehandling på kommandoraden jämfört med verktyg som jq och gron.

Reaktioner

  • Debatten fokuserar på att möjliggöra användaråtkomliga filsystemfunktioner på operativsystem som macOS, som står inför utmaningar på grund av Apples API-begränsningar och beroende av verktyg från tredje part som osxfuse.
  • Användare är frustrerade över Apples begränsningar för externa utvecklare, vilket leder till oro för tillförlitlighet och dataintegritet, vilket leder till förslag som att utnyttja NFS.
  • Diskussionerna omfattar även innovativa idéer som att montera Git-kommiteringar som ett filsystem, behandla buffertar som filer och mappa XML till ett filsystem med XPath-teknik, och utforskar tekniska detaljer och potentiella för- och nackdelar inom teknikbranschen.

Penpot 2.0: Det nya webbaserade designverktyget med öppen källkod för sömlöst samarbete

  • Penpot 2.0 är en ny version av ett webbaserat designverktyg med öppen källkod som främjar samarbete mellan designers och utvecklare.
  • Användare kan själva hosta Penpot och dra nytta av dess integrationer, öppna design och stödjande community, med vittnesmål som lyfter fram dess användarvänliga kontroller och utvecklarfokuserade funktioner.
  • Verktyget utnyttjar webb- och utvecklingsstandarder på ett smart sätt för att förbättra design- och utvecklingsprocessen och främja ett sömlöst arbetsflöde, vilket visades på konferensen Penpot Fest som främjar samarbete mellan designers och utvecklare.

Reaktioner

  • Dialogen kontrasterar designverktyg med öppen källkod som Inkscape och Penpot med proprietära val som Figma, och betonar fördelar och utmaningar.
  • Inkscape får beröm för sin användarvänlighet med SVG (Scalable Vector Graphics), och Blenders övergång till öppen källkod uppmärksammas.
  • Samarbetet mellan designers och utvecklare betonas som avgörande för användarupplevelsen (UX) inom mjukvaruutveckling, och visar på olika åsikter om Figma kontra verktyg som Penpot för UI-design.

Europas entreprenöriella väckarklocka

  • Författaren utmanar stereotyper genom att visa upp de europeiska entreprenörernas hårda arbete och risktagande mentalitet, och motverkar därmed uppfattningen att européer är lata och riskbenägna jämfört med amerikaner.
  • Bland förslagen finns att införa en standardiserad juridisk enhet i EU, förbättra utbildningen i engelska och sträva efter att bygga en enhetlig företagsmarknad för att hantera hinder som variationer i lagstiftningen och begränsat stöd i ett tidigt skede för nystartade företag.
  • Dessa förslag syftar till att skapa en mer gynnsam miljö för entreprenörskap i Europa och uppmuntra beslutsfattare att ompröva strategier för att stimulera kontinentens entreprenörslandskap.

Reaktioner

  • Skillnader i arbetskultur visar på risktagande hos amerikanska mjukvaruutvecklare jämfört med säkerhetstänkandet i Europa.
  • San Francisco utmärker sig som ett unikt centrum för risktagande och långa arbetsdagar inom den amerikanska tekniksektorn, vilket påverkar produktiviteten och anställningsrutinerna.
  • Samtalet fördjupar sig i de utmaningar som europeiska teknikföretag står inför efter Brexit och betonar vikten av att kunna engelska och att investera för att konkurrera med den dominerande amerikanska marknaden inom AI.

Utforska neurala nätverk med differentierbar programmering

  • "Alice's Adventures in a Differentiable Wonderland" är en bok som introducerar neurala nätverk och differentierbar programmering, med tonvikt på automatisk differentiering för att optimera funktioner.
  • Boken tar upp designtekniker för sekvenser, grafer, texter och ljud, med fokus på convolutional, attentional och recurrent block, och använder PyTorch och JAX för att förklara avancerade modeller som stora språkmodeller och multimodala arkitekturer.
  • Ytterligare kapitel kommer att fördjupa sig i ämnen som återanvändning av modeller, densitetsuppskattning, villkorlig beräkning och felsökning av modeller, i syfte att överbrygga teori och praktisk kodimplementering.

Reaktioner

  • Diskussionen omfattar optimering av neurala nätverk med hjälp av differentierbara primitiver och utmaningarna med gradientbaserade metoder som stokastisk gradientnedstigning och slumpmässig viktstörning.
  • Tonvikten ligger på att beskriva algoritmer på ett korrekt sätt, att förstå matematiska begrepp på djupet, att införliva Jacobimatriser och att skilja mellan funktionell och traditionell programmering i neurala nätverk.
  • Debatter om förhållandet mellan artificiella neuronnät och biologiska neuroner, där man tar upp skillnader i beräkningskraft, operationer, generalisering av gradienter och potentiella juridiska frågor relaterade till immateriella rättigheter.

Tesla säger upp hela Supercharger-teamet

  • Tesla genomför ytterligare uppsägningar, där hela Supercharger-teamet påverkas av neddragningarna.
  • Företagets beslut att inkludera Supercharger-teamet i nedskärningarna har väckt uppmärksamhet på grund av vikten av Supercharger-nätverket i Teslas infrastruktur.

Reaktioner

  • Aktieägarna diskuterar Elon Musks ledarskap, beslutsfattande och nyligen genomförda uppsägningar, inklusive ett aktiebidrag på 55 miljarder dollar.
  • Oro väcks för SpaceX och Teslas hållbarhet och lönsamhet, Musks beteendeförändringar och anställningstrygghet i företag.
  • Frågor kvarstår om Musks effektivitet som ledare, framtiden för hans företag och hur hans beslut påverkar deras värdering och framgång.

DEA omklassificerar cannabis från schema I till III

  • DEA kommer att omklassificera cannabis från Schedule I till Schedule III baserat på en rekommendation från Department of Health and Human Services, och erkänner dess terapeutiska fördelar.
  • Trots omklassificeringen kvarstår utmaningar på grund av skillnaderna mellan delstatliga och federala cannabislagar.
  • Processen omfattar granskning av Vita husets Office of Management and Budget, feedback från allmänheten, administrativa utfrågningar och ett slutligt beslut innan några förändringar genomförs.

Reaktioner

  • DEA har accepterat omklassificeringen av cannabis efter vägledning från en hälsoorganisation.
  • Detta beslut innebär en betydande förändring av cannabis rättsliga status.
  • För ytterligare information, vänligen se den länk som tillhandahålls.

Frigör kreativiteten med StoryDiffusion

  • StoryDiffusion är ett mångsidigt verktyg som utnyttjar konsekvent självuppmärksamhet för att skapa imponerande serier, högkvalitativa videor och upprätthålla karaktärskonsistens.
  • Den genererar konsekventa bilder av tecknade figurer, hanterar flera figur-ID:n samtidigt och kan införliva bilder som användaren matar in som villkor.
  • Verktyget är inspirerat av Bulmas stil och använder en rörelseprediktor för att förbättra kvaliteten och göra det mer unikt.

Reaktioner

  • StoryDiffusion är ett verktyg för att generera bilder och videor med naturliga rörelser, även om användare har noterat kontinuitetsfel.
  • Användare diskuterar användningen av generativ AI för att skapa nischat innehåll och potentiell skräppost, och uttrycker oro över GitHub-länkens integritet och kvaliteten på autogenererade e-böcker på Amazon.
  • Samtalet går på djupet och utforskar möjligheterna och begränsningarna med generativ AI-teknik.

Arti: Rust-projekt som implementerar Tor-anonymitetsprotokoll

  • Arti är ett Rust-projekt som implementerar Tor-anonymitetsprotokoll, vilket ger en funktionell Tor-klient med tidigt stöd för löktjänster.
  • Utveckling pågår för att förbättra säkerheten så att den matchar C Tor-implementeringen, vilket gör att den för närvarande endast är lämplig för experimentella ändamål.
  • Den senaste versionen är version 1.2.0, som erbjuder olika resurser som README, källförvar, API-dokumentation, riktlinjer för bidrag, vanliga frågor och Tor-relaterade detaljer.

Reaktioner

  • Artikeln handlar om Arti, en Tor-implementering kodad i Rust, och ger insikter om dess utveckling, finansiering och förslag på experimentell användning.
  • En debatt utspelar sig om Artis nuvarande tillstånd och potentiella säkerhetsrisker, vilket uppmärksammar viktiga överväganden för användarna.
  • Arti in Rust erbjuder ett unikt perspektiv på Tor-implementeringar och har väckt intresse på grund av sina utvecklingsaspekter och säkerhetsimplikationer.